Assistant General Counsel – Employment Law, North America This is a remote role, ideally located in Eastern time zone. This candidate will report to the General Counsel and be an integral member of the legal team responsible for the day-to-day legal work related to employment law matters.

Requirements

  • JD degree from a nationally recognized law school
  • Admitted to the Bar of at least one state and eligible for admission as in-house counsel.
  • 6 years or more of legal experience as US employment law attorney.

Responsibilities

  • Provide direct legal support on a full range of North American employment law issues relating to the entire employee lifecycle, including but not limited to: recruiting, hiring, training, performance management, compensation, leaves of absence, return to work and accommodation issues, benefits, terminations, and other employment related topics
  • Advise on labor and employment law compliance, including but not limited to wage and hour laws, labor laws, health and safety, discrimination, harassment, leave and disability accommodation laws, and other employment related laws and regulations
  • Oversee and direct internal investigations in addition to managing litigation, claims, agency charges, and government investigations internally.
  • Develop, revise, and implement best in class employment policies, procedures, and scalable training solutions
  • Oversee external counsel support for non-US employment law issues.
